Profile of The Protector
The mood of The Protector is exciting and suspenseful. The plot centers around a one-man army, being down on your luck, and a master warrior. It is a drama, foreign, and thriller movie. Stylistically, The Protector features martial arts. In approach, it is serious and realistic. The pacing is fast. The Protector is set in Australia and Asia. It happens in contemporary times. It is especially suggested for a boys' night. Note that The Protector includes strong violent content.
Summary of The Protector
This sequel to 2005's ONG-BAK: THE THAI WARRIOR sees director Prachya Pinkaew returning to tell an action-packed story that revolves around a missing elephant that turns up in Australia.
